HomeMy WebLinkAboutRES 225 Draft 01 2022-2024A RESOLUTION TRANSFERRING/APPROPRIATING AN APPROPRIATION OUT AND FROM A DESIGNATED FUND ACCOUNT AND CREDITING SAME TO A DESIGNATED FUND ACCOUNT TO PROVIDE A GRANT TO THE FRIENDS OF FIRST
RESPONDERS TO ASSIST WITH EXPENSES FOR APPRECIATION WEEKS IN 2024.
WHEREAS, in 1974 President Gerald Ford declared the first “National Emergency Medical Services Week” to honor those who provide both help and hope when tragedy strikes our communities;
and
WHEREAS, the Friends of First Responders (FOFR) is working in collaboration with our island first responder agencies, which includes but is not limited to, police, fire, emergency medical
services, corrections, sheriffs, park rangers, and Civil Defense to support the Appreciation Weeks in 2024; and
WHEREAS, Public Safety Telecommunications Week will be held April 14-20, 2024; Corrections Week on May 5-11, 2024; Police Week on May 12-18, 2024; and Emergency Medical Services (EMS)
on May 19-24, 2024; and
WHEREAS, FOFR is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that is committed to providing support and resources to strengthen the health and wellness of first responders and their families;
and
WHEREAS, FOFR is requesting funds to assist with expenses toward “Appreciation Weeks” in 2024, for Police, EMS, Corrections and Public Safety Telecommunications to acknowledge, honor
and commend first responders in Hawai‘i County; and
WHEREAS, one of the goals of the Police Department is to provide critical stress management and support for peer units and personnel for the overall well-being of first responders; and
WHEREAS, pursuant to Section 2-139(a)(2)(A) of the Hawai‘i County Code, Contingency Relief funds shall be transferred to an accepting County department/agency via resolution identifying
the nonprofit organization and the specific program, project, event, activity, service, equipment, materials, or supplies for which the grant shall be used; now, therefore,
B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E COUNTY OF HAWAI‘I that Contingency Relief funds from Council District 8 will be appropriated to the Police Department to provide a grant to the Friends
of First Responders to assist with expenses for Appreciation Week in 2024.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Council of the County of Hawai‘i hereby transfers/appropriates the following amount as set forth below:
FUND: General
AMOUNT OF
APPROPRIATION: $5,000
OUT AND FROM:
010.101.5101.91 Clerk-Council SVC – Contingency Relief $5,000
CREDITED TO:
010.201.5203.02 Police Department $5,000
Police Adm Div-Oce
235 Misc Materials & Supplies
(FOFR - Appreciation Weeks in 2024)
BE IT FINALLY RESOLVED that the County Clerk shall transmit a copy of this resolution to the Chief of Police and Director of Finance, and that the Director of Finance is hereby authorized
to make the necessary transfers in accordance with the terms of this resolution.
